This is one thing I really don't like so far, when you uninstall a program it leaves behind a bunch of files.

If the app came with an installer, see if it has an uninstaller (oddly, it may be an option in the installer). Some do, some don't, but most of the ones that do will uninstall the other files, too.


There are some 3rd-party apps that try to remove such files, such as AppZapper.
